About this book
Is there any worse violation of humanity than all the massive injustice and dreadful evils that human beings do to each other through armed violence and war? And consequentially does not every person should have a human-rights claim to live in peace?The classic documents do not include any human right to peace. It is only since the concept of three generations of human rights was developed a few decades ago that controversies have developed - mainly among experts, and hardly ever in public - over whether this type of human right exists or ought to exist. Witschen discusses the core issues in the debate from the point of view of legal ethics. Independently of whether or not postulating a human right to peace is justifiable, there is no doubt that a human rights-based approach to peacemaking is promising.
